Article: Notices of area layoffs proliferate

Already enduring the steepest job slump in decades, the Milwaukee area received word of further cutback plans Wednesday, including an unspecified number of local jobs at Bucyrus International and 254 positions at American General Life Cos.

Bucyrus, the South Milwaukee-based mining equipment manufacturer, said in a statement that the global economic downturn has shrunk demand for its equipment.

"Because of this, we have reduced both our production and non- production personnel at our South Milwaukee location," the company said in its statement.
